Hi all,

I run some Windows 8 and 7 machines where I want to run some mining software. I want to test several pools and several coins.

My questions: I don't understand why i get some results on some settings and sometimes it doesn't work:

Example that's not running:
the pool site says:
Quote
If you use a command-line miner, type:
./cgminer --scrypt  -o stratum+tcp://doge.cryptovalley.com:3333 -u Weblogin.Worker -p Worker password
I try to run cgminer-3.8.4-windows
with
Quote
cgminer --scrypt  -o stratum+tcp://doge.cryptovalley.com:3333 -u MyNick.1 -p MyWorkerPW
miner stops because it doesn't understand "--scrypt"


With old mining software, I got it running:
CGMiner 2.10.4
Quote
cgminer -o stratum+tcp://nl1.ghash.io:3334 -u MyNick.1 -p MyWorkerPW

I have access to Windows 7 and 8 machines, i5 CPUs, NVidia graphic cards (yes, i know they are slower than AMD), but I will not buy hardware before I understand how to get it running.

Anyone can help me understand what miner software I should use?

The last version of CGMiner that supported alt coins and GPU's was 3.7.2.

Moving forward CGMiner only supports ASIC's and Bitcoin.

I've only used Ufasoft, 3 years ago when I first started, and CGminer.  I have only mined Bitcoin, so I know nothing about alt's.

So I would probably use CGMiner 3.7.2 or earlier.  Also the scrypt/GPU development has been taken over by others, from what I understand.
